Window Roller Repair in Overland Park, KS
Window roller repair services address issues with the mechanisms that allow windows to open and close smoothly. These repairs typ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or worn-out roller components on sliding windows, such as those found in patios, balconies, or large picture windows. Property owners often seek this service when windows become difficult to operate, stick, or make noise during movement, ensuring they can maintain proper ventilation, security, and ease of use in their homes.
Before requesting window roller rep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work needed, including whether the entire roller assembly requires replacement or if only specific parts need attention. It’s helpful to know the type of window, the age of the hardware, and any visible damage or misalignment. Clarifying these details can ensure the repair process addresses the root cause of the issue and restores smooth, reliable window operation.

Window Roller Repair Questions
What causes window roller issues? Common causes include dirt buildup, worn-out rollers, or misalignment, which can hinder smooth operation.
How can I tell if my window rollers need repair? Difficulty opening or closing the window, unusual noises, or the window sticking are signs that rollers may need attention.
Are repairs suitable for all types of windows? Repairs can be performed on most standard window types, including casement, double-hung, and sliding windows.
What maintenance helps prevent roller problems? Regular cleaning and lubrication of rollers can help maintain smooth operation and extend their lifespan.
